Troubleshooting Questions and Answers:

1. Q: My Hp Pavilion touchscreen is not responding. What can I do?
A: Please make sure that the Hp Pavilion Touchscreen Driver for Windows 10 is installed and up to date. You can download the driver from the official HP website and install it.

2. Q: Why is my Hp Pavilion touchscreen displaying erratic behavior?
A: Check if your device is running on the latest version of Windows 10. If not, consider updating the Windows OS to the latest version as this could resolve any compatibility issues. Also, ensure that you have installed any available updates for the Hp Pavilion Touchscreen Driver.

3. Q: I seem to be experiencing issues with the Hp Pavilion touchscreen after a recent Windows update. What should I do?
A: In such cases, it is recommended to try rolling back the Windows update to the previous version. You can do this by going to Settings > Update & Security > Windows Update > View update history > Uninstall updates. Look for the recent update that could have caused the issue and uninstall it. Additionally, you can also check for any updated drivers on the HP website specifically designed to address post-update issues.
